What Type Of Individual Bankruptcy Can One File For?

When it comes to filing for bankruptcy for individuals, the choice is often between Chapter 7 and 13. They are titled chapters since each one outlines the purpose as well as terms and conditions under which one can file for bankruptcy under it. A general opinion on bankruptcy summarizes what Chapter 7 is all about. A trustee or a caretaker is appointed to overlook all your assets. Some of it will have to be handed over to the trustee. He in turn will sell this off to repay part of your debt. The laws for bankruptcy vary from state to state and this will determine how much equity in your property you will be allowed to retain. Also in this chapter, with all this done, your debt stands to be cancelled. If you want to file for bankruptcy under Chapter 7, you should be eligible under the income restrictions that it stipulates. Also if you have already applied for Chapter 7 bankruptcy and been rejected in the past six months, then you will not be allowed to file under it. Further you will not be eligible for a discharge if you had one granted the past 8 years. Considering Alternatives To Bankruptcy

Filing for bankruptcy is something that is undertaken when all other options have run out. Extreme financial trouble is often what results in debts remaining unclear. If you plan to continue this way, your credit ratings stand to be affected. Soon you may not even be able to get a small loan to help you tide over a bad patch. Filing for bankruptcy in its self is a tremendous step and one that has to be taken after a lot of thought.Before you actually decide to take the plunge, you should consider a few alternatives. The fact that there are alternatives does not occur to many since filing for bankruptcy is often kept secret till the last minute. Getting the right advice is essential on all your options before you take the final step. Some of your creditors may have taken you to court over pending settlements. You could consider an out-of-court settlement in such cases. This would mean negotiating with your creditors and opting to pay a lump sum amount that may be a little lower than the whole sum owed.
